Groovy在测试自动化领域有以下作用:
-
编写测试脚本:Groovy是一种功能强大的脚本语言,可以用于编写测试脚本,包括单元测试、集成测试、端到端测试等各种类型的测试。
-
操作测试工具:Groovy可以与各种测试工具集成,例如Selenium、Appium、Jenkins等,可以使用Groovy脚本来操作这些工具进行自动化测试。
-
数据驱动测试:Groovy支持灵活的数据结构和语法,可以轻松地进行数据驱动测试,通过不同的数据来执行测试用例,提高测试覆盖率。
-
定制测试框架:Groovy可以作为脚本语言来编写自定义的测试框架,满足特定需求的测试自动化流程。
总的来说,Groovy在测试自动化领域可以帮助测试团队更高效、灵活地进行自动化测试,提升测试效率和质量。